Consent banner rollout for Thimbleworks proceeds in three rings: staff, beta tenants, then all regions. Advance a ring only after opt-in telemetry confirms the banner renders and choices persist. Rollback is a single flag flip in Lanternfall; no deploy needed. Current ring status and the flag history are tracked on the page below.

wiki page, tahaf-tajog: https://jira.ordindyn.corp/pipeline

## Break-Glass Access — GiftLeaf Receipt Mailer

The GiftLeaf donation-receipt mailer runs under the nonprofit ops account at Brindlewood Trust. If the mailer stalls mid-batch and the on-call admin is unreachable, break-glass access lets a second operator resume the queue so donors receive year-end receipts on time. Usage is logged and reviewed within 24 hours by the stewardship team. Access requires the emergency console plus the recovery passphrase. The passphrase for break-glass entry is below.

unlock words, yawig-kagef: gordor-holvan-ulaael-pramir-ulaiel-tamdor

Management Meeting Minutes — Reseller Programme

Present: Dena Forsgate, Ollie Rennick, Priya Calloway.

Quick recap: the Fernlight reseller programme is tracking ahead of plan — 14 partners signed versus the 10 we'd hoped for. Margins are a bit thinner than modelled, mostly down to the tiered discount we offered early joiners. Ollie will tighten the discount bands before the next intake. Where we want to take the programme next is covered in the note below.

board note of yahip-tadug: Headcount on the Zorath team goes from 9 to 100 by the end of April. Gross margin on Zorath came in at 10 percent against a plan of 20 percent.

Document Transport — Print Shop Master Copies

Quick guide for moving master copies to Bramblehurst Print Co. These are the only originals, so treat the run like a valuables transfer, not a regular parcel drop. Use the red tamper-evident envelopes from the supply shelf, log the seal number in the transport book, and never combine the run with general mail. The masters go directly to the press supervisor, nobody else. On arrival, the courier must follow the hand-over instruction stated below.

drop instructions, kajep-tageg: the kasvan casdor courier leaves the quenvan quenox druox ledger at gate 4316 under passcode 799004